4-Chloropyridinium chloride(7379-35-3)

4-Chloropyridinium chloride(7379-35-3)
Product IdentificationBack to Contents
【Product Name】

4-Chloropyridinium chloride
【Synonyms】

Pyridine, 4-chloro-, hydrochloride
【CAS】

7379-35-3
【Formula】

C5H5Cl2N
【Molecular Weight】

150.01
【EINECS】

230-946-1
【RTECS】

US6300000
【Beilstein/Gmelin】

3684904
【Beilstein Reference】

5-20-05-00410
【EC Class】

harmful, irritant
Physical and Chemical PropertiesBack to Contents
【Appearance】

Light yellow crystalline powder.
【Vapor Density】

5.2
First Aid MeasuresBack to Contents
【Ingestion】

Never give anything by mouth to an unconscious person. Get medical aid. Do NOT induce vomiting. If conscious and alert, rinse mouth and drink 2-4 cupfuls of milk or water.
【Inhalation】

Remove from exposure to fresh air immediately. If not breathing, give artificial respiration. If breathing is difficult, give oxygen. Get medical aid.
【Skin】

Get medical aid. Flush skin with plenty of soap and water for at least 15 minutes while removing contaminated clothing and shoes. Wash clothing before reuse.
【Eyes】

Flush eyes with plenty of water for at least 15 minutes, occasionally lifting the upper and lower eyelids. Get medical aid.
Handling and StorageBack to Contents
【Storage】

Store in a tightly closed container. Store in a cool, dry, well-ventilated area away from incompatible substances.
【Handling】

Wash thoroughly after handling. Use with adequate ventilation. Avoid contact with eyes, skin, and clothing. Keep container tightly closed. Avoid ingestion and inhalation. Wash clothing before reuse.
Hazards IdentificationBack to Contents
【Ingestion】

May cause gastrointestinal irritation with nausea, vomiting and diarrhea. The toxicological properties of this substance have not been fully investigated.
【Inhalation】

May cause respiratory tract irritation. The toxicological properties of this substance have not been fully investigated.
【Skin】

Causes skin irritation. The toxicological properties of this material have not been fully investigated.
【Eyes】

Causes eye irritation.
【Hazards】

Contact with metals may evolve flammable hydrogen gas.
【EC Risk Phrase】

R 20/21/22 36/37/38
【EC Safety Phrase】

S 22 26 36/37/39
【UN (DOT)】

2811
Exposure Controls/Personal ProtectionBack to Contents
【Personal Protection】

Eyes: Wear appropriate protective eyeglasses or chemical safety goggles as described by OSHA's eye and face protection regulations in 29 CFR 1910.133 or European Standard EN166. Skin: Wear appropriate protective gloves to prevent skin exposure. Clothing: Wear appropriate protective clothing to prevent skin exposure.
【Respirators】

Follow the OSHA respirator regulations found in 29CFR 1910.134 or European Standard EN 149. Always use a NIOSH or European Standard EN 149 approved respirator when necessary.
Fire Fighting MeasuresBack to Contents
【Autoignition】

525
【Fire Fighting】

Wear a self-contained breathing apparatus in pressure-demand, MSHA/NIOSH (approved or equivalent), and full protective gear. During a fire, irritating and highly toxic gases may be generated by thermal decomposition or combustion. Extinguishing media: Use agent most appropriate to extinguish fire. In case of fire use water spray, dry chemical, carbon dioxide, or appropriate foam.
【Fire Potential】

Non-combustible, substance itself does not burn but may decompose upon heating to produce corrosive and/or toxic fumes.
Accidental Release MeasuresBack to Contents
【Small spills/leaks】

Clean up spills immediately, using the appropriate protective equipment. Sweep up, then place into a suitable container for disposal. Avoid generating dusty conditions. Provide ventilation.
Stability and ReactivityBack to Contents
【Disposal Code】

3
【Incompatibilities】

Oxidizing agents.
【Stability】

Stable at room temperature in closed containers under normal storage and handling conditions.
【Decomposition】

Hydrogen chloride, nitrogen oxides, carbon monoxide, irritating and toxic fumes and gases, carbon dioxide, nitrogen.
【Combustion Products】

Fire may produce irritating, corrosive and/or toxic gases.
Transport InformationBack to Contents
【UN Number】

2811
【Hazard Class】

6.1
【Packing Group】

I; II; III
【HS Code】

2933 39 99
